2024年4月22日发(作者:菠萝直播)
使用终端命令在macOS中设置网络连接
在macOS操作系统中,我们可以使用终端命令来设置网络连接,
这种方法可以帮助我们快速配置网络设置,而无需打开图形界面中的
网络偏好设置。本文将介绍使用终端命令在macOS中设置网络连接的
步骤和相关命令。
一、查看当前网络连接信息
在使用终端命令之前,我们首先需要查看当前的网络连接信息。我
们可以使用以下命令来获取当前网络接口的详细信息:
```bash
networksetup -listallhardwareports
```
该命令会列出所有网络接口的信息,包括接口名称和设备名称。找
到与我们要配置的网络连接对应的接口信息,以便后续的配置。
二、配置网络连接
1. 配置静态IP地址
如果我们希望将网络连接配置为静态IP地址,可以使用以下命令:
```bash
sudo networksetup -setmanual
```
其中,`
`
`
举个例子,如果我们要将以太网连接(en0)的IP地址配置为静态
IP地址为192.168.1.100,子网掩码为255.255.255.0,网关为
192.168.1.1,我们可以使用以下命令:
```bash
sudo networksetup -setmanual en0 192.168.1.100 255.255.255.0
192.168.1.1
```
2. 配置动态获取IP地址(DHCP)
如果我们希望将网络连接配置为自动获取IP地址(使用DHCP),
可以使用以下命令:
```bash
sudo networksetup -setdhcp
```
例如,如果我们要将Wi-Fi连接(en1)配置为自动获取IP地址,
可以使用以下命令:
```bash
sudo networksetup -setdhcp en1
```
3. 配置DNS服务器
除了配置IP地址外,我们还可以使用终端命令来配置DNS服务器。
可以使用以下命令来设置主DNS服务器和备用DNS服务器:
```bash
sudo networksetup -setdnsservers
```
其中,`
`
举个例子,如果我们要将Wi-Fi连接(en1)的主DNS服务器设置
为8.8.8.8,备用DNS服务器设置为8.8.4.4,可以使用以下命令:
```bash
sudo networksetup -setdnsservers en1 8.8.8.8 8.8.4.4
```
三、验证网络连接设置
完成以上步骤后,我们可以使用以下命令来验证网络连接的配置是
否生效:
```bash
networksetup -getinfo
```
其中,`
例如,我们可以使用以下命令来验证以太网连接(en0)的网络连
接状态:
```bash
networksetup -getinfo en0
```
命令输出会显示该网络连接的详细信息,包括IP地址、子网掩码、
网关、DNS服务器等。
总结:
本文介绍了在macOS中使用终端命令配置网络连接的方法。通过
终端命令,我们可以快速设置静态IP地址、自动获取IP地址和配置
DNS服务器,从而方便地进行网络连接的配置。使用终端命令可以提
高效率,并在一些情况下更加便捷。在进行网络连接设置时,请确保
仔细核对接口名称和相关参数,以免配置错误导致网络连接异常。
通过上述步骤,您可以根据需要在macOS中使用终端命令来设置
网络连接,实现更加灵活和个性化的网络配置。希望本文对您有所帮
助。
发布者:admin,转转请注明出处:http://www.yc00.com/xitong/1713768336a2314722.html
评论列表(0条)